What is Doosan Excavator Fault Code E001136-03?

Fault Code E001136-03 indicates a hydraulic pump solenoid valve circuit malfunction, specifically detecting an abnormal electrical signal or short circuit in the main pump control system. This diagnostic trouble code (DTC) is generated when the Electronic Control Module (ECM) detects voltage or current irregularities in the solenoid valve circuit that regulates hydraulic pump displacement on Doosan excavators.

This code directly affects the machine's hydraulic system performance, as the pump solenoid valves are responsible for modulating hydraulic flow based on operational demands. When this circuit malfunctions, the ECM cannot properly control pump output, leading to reduced efficiency, erratic hydraulic response, or complete loss of hydraulic functions. For used excavators, this fault often signals deteriorating electrical connections or component wear that requires immediate attention to prevent further damage to the hydraulic system.

Common Symptoms

  • Reduced hydraulic power across all functions, with noticeably slower boom, arm, and bucket movements
  • Engine warning light illuminated on the instrument panel with possible audible alarm
  • Erratic hydraulic response where functions surge or respond unpredictably to joystick inputs
  • Machine entering derate mode, limiting engine RPM to protect the hydraulic system
  • Complete loss of hydraulic functions in severe cases, rendering the excavator inoperable

Potential Causes

The E001136-03 code typically stems from electrical circuit issues rather than mechanical pump failures. Damaged wiring harnesses are extremely common in used machines, particularly where harness routing passes near rotating components or sharp edges on the main pump assembly. Corroded or loose connector pins at the solenoid valve connection point frequently cause intermittent contact and abnormal resistance readings.

Failed pump solenoid valves themselves may develop internal short circuits after thousands of operating hours. ECM internal faults are less common but possible in older excavators with high hour meters. Water intrusion into electrical connectors during washing or working in wet conditions accelerates corrosion and circuit degradation.

How to Troubleshoot and Fix Code E001136-03

Step 1: Visual Inspection Begin by thoroughly inspecting the wiring harness running from the ECM to the hydraulic pump solenoid valves. Look for abraded insulation, pinched wires, or evidence of harness contact with hot or moving components. On used excavators, check all connector boots for cracks that allow moisture penetration.

Step 2: Electrical Testing Using a digital multimeter, disconnect the solenoid valve connector and measure resistance across the solenoid coil terminals (typically 8-15 ohms for Doosan systems). Check for short circuits to ground by measuring resistance between each terminal and the pump housing—readings should show infinite resistance. Verify supply voltage at the harness connector with ignition on (should read battery voltage, approximately 12-24V depending on system).

Step 3: Component Testing and Replacement If electrical values are correct, test solenoid valve operation using Doosan diagnostic software to command the valve while monitoring current draw. Replace the solenoid valve if it fails to actuate or draws excessive current. For used machines with confirmed harness damage, repair or replace the affected section, ensuring proper routing away from wear points and securing with appropriate protective loom and tie wraps.
